Saying it with flowers....
So I was making some more tufts as im running out, and I was thinking about how to make taller flower stems.
The idea I came up with was nylon thread or fishing line if you have it.
Trim to length, coat in pva and wave over the magic box, all there is to it really. once its dried dab with glue and add coloured flock.
Once ready, add a spot of super glue to the end and jab it into an existing tuft to hide the base.
